Within the framework of the Baku City Education Department and Qafqazinfo's "Let's get to know our heroic teachers" project, we present to readers the biography of Ulvi Gurbanov, a teacher who participated in the Great Patriotic War:

 

Ulvi Faig oglu Gurbanov was born in 1993. He took part in the glorious victory in the Great Patriotic War and taught patriotism on the battlefield.

 

Having been involved in karate and wrestling since childhood, U. Gurbanov has achieved brilliant victories in a number of domestic and international competitions. He won a bronze medal at the 2007 World Karate Championships, a silver medal at the 2008 European Championships, and a European wrestling champion in 2012.

 

In 2011, he graduated from secondary school No. 288 in Baku. In 2011-2015 he studied at the Azerbaijan State Academy of Physical Culture and Sports.

 

During his military service, U. Gurbanov, who showed great heroism in the direction of Talysh village in the war that entered the history of Azerbaijan in 2016 as the April battles, was awarded "Service Certificate" and "Letter of Appreciation" for his service.

 

U. Gurbanov, who started his teaching career at secondary school No. 184 in Baku, has been working as a physical education teacher at secondary school No. 166 in the capital since 2020.

 

U. Gurbanov, who went to the volunteer front as soon as the Patriotic War broke out, took an active part in the battles in Fizuli, Jabrayil, Khojavend and Shusha. He was awarded honorary diplomas for his services in the Great Patriotic War.

 

Heroic teacher U. Gurbanov, a European champion, says he will be proud to be a victorious warrior of the Great Patriotic War and a successful teacher of Azerbaijani education for a lifetime.
